Definición
'Fro' means away from a starting point, often used with 'to' as 'to and fro' to describe a back-and-forth movement.

Escucha en Contexto
The boat moved to and fro on the water.
Children ran to and fro in the playground.
She looked to and fro, searching for her lost keys.
People paced to and fro nervously before the meeting began.
